So, what with all the talk about Skyrim and getting bored with Mount and Blade, I decided to finally install the Witcher (the first one) and play it. I had once tried the demo and thought that was terrible, but when I started a new game I found out I can actually use a mouse + keyboard combination (third person view) instead of an isometric view, so I was pretty excited.

Seriously. Imagine an engaging, fun, intuitive and responsive combat system (I think Mount & Blade is pretty much that). Now imagine the exact opposite of that and you have the Witcher's combat system. They took the typical MMORPG combat system, stripped it of all features that have anything to do with player skill/input (of which there isn't much in MMORPGs anyway) and for good measure made it unintuitive and unresponsive. The player must click on an enemy to target him, as in MMORPGs, but unlike MMORPGs this directly affects the way in which the player character moves, which is really weird and makes it feel like the character is doing something and the player has hardly any control over his character. On one occasion my character suddenly made a stupid jump/backflip/whatever combination for no reason at all, straight in front of another enemy who was about to hit someone else and subsequently hit me. Then, if the player has, with great pains, successfully moved his character in front of the targeted enemy, he has to click on said enemy to attack? Right? The game says so, but I can't find out whether anything is happening. My character moves, but it is totally unclear whether he is actually attacking the enemy or getting hit by that enemy. There are no clear animations that show what's happening and there are a few numbers floating above our heads but it's also unclear whom those numbers affect (compare that to M&B: if the player attacks an enemy, it makes a clear sound whether he hit the enemy properly, only slightly, hit his shield or missed the enemy altogether; if it was a successful hit his sword becomes bloody as does the enemy's face, and the game tells exactly who hit whom and how much damage he dealt).
